The case study leads with a net-new capability: the Angeleno Account did not exist before, and dozens of fragmented custom-built systems could not deliver it. That makes New Capability the right primary tag even though efficiency gains (automated provisioning, reduced manual remediation, freed developer hours) are woven throughout. The bot detection anecdote is concrete and quotable, grounding an otherwise abstract identity story in a real attack stopped.
The specific bot-detection vignette: a named attacker type, a named feature deployed, and a clear before-and-after outcome told in two sentences by a named executive. It turns a platform feature into a human-scale win without inventing a metric.
